
O is for Old School: A Hip Hop Alphabet for B.I.G. Kids Who Used to be Dope
by James Tyler Author and Ella Cohen Illustrator
This playful hip-hop alphabet book takes parents on a nostalgic journey through iconic hip-hop terms and phrases, reimagined for the parenting world. Each letter of the alphabet is tied to a hip-hop expression, with meanings now given a humorous parenting twist—like "Peace" referring to nap time or "Flow" meaning something a little messier. It lets parents relive their "Old School" days while introducing their little ones to the ABCs in a fresh, fun way. With a glossary at the back for any slang that needs decoding, it’s a playful celebration of both hip-hop culture and the joys (and challenges) of parenthood.
